The Advanced Certificate in Cloud Computing for Endangered Species Conservation is a comprehensive program designed to equip participants with the necessary skills and knowledge to leverage cloud computing technologies for wildlife conservation efforts. The course covers a wide range of topics, including data management, analysis, and visualization in the cloud environment, as well as best practices for ensuring data security and privacy.
Upon completion of the program, participants will be able to implement cloud-based solutions to address conservation challenges, optimize data workflows, and collaborate effectively with stakeholders in the field. They will also gain practical experience working with cloud computing platforms such as Amazon Web Services (AWS) and Microsoft Azure, enhancing their technical proficiency in this area.
